




已阅读5页,还剩2页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
控制系统的数学模型一、控制系统的参数模型1、多项式模型线性定常系统的数学模型传递函数G(s)一般可以表示成:其中分子分母多项式中的an与bm均为常系数。MATLAB语言描述:构造分子多项式:num=bm,bm-1,b1,b0;或num=bm bm-1 b1 b0构造分母多项式:den=an,an-1,a1,a0;或den=an an-1 a1 a0构造并显示传递函数:printsys(num,den);其中num与den是习惯用法,也可用其它变量名代替,但在显示时会出现num/den,这是通用输出显示格式,与输入变量名称无关。例1:num=1 12 44 48;den=1 16 86 176 105;printsys(num,den)显示:num/den = s3 + 12 s2 + 44 s + 48-s4 + 16 s3 + 86 s2 + 176 s + 105例2:系统开环传递函数为写出多项式模型。n=conv(5,1 1);d=conv(1 0 0,conv(1 2,1 6 10);printsys(n,d)显示:num/den = 5 s + 5 - s5 + 8 s4 + 22 s3 + 20 s22、模型的连接函数num=cloop()用于计算单位反馈时闭环传递函数多项式模型的参数向量,右变量为开环参数,左变量返回系统的闭环参数,反馈极性1为正反馈,-1为负反馈。例3:系统开环传递函数为写出单位负反馈时闭环传递函数的多项式模型。numo=conv(5,1 1);deno=conv(1 0 0,1 3);numc,denc=cloop(numo,deno,-1);printsys(numc,denc)显示:num/den=5 s + 5 - s3 + 3 s2 + 5 s + 5函数=feedback()用于计算一般反馈系统的闭环传递函数。其格式为:num,den=feedback(num1,den1,num2,den2,sign) 前向传递函数G(S)为num1/den1,反馈传递函数H(S)为num2/den2,右变量为G(S)与H(s)的参数,左变量返回系统的闭环参数,反馈极性sign取1为正反馈,取-1为负反馈,缺省时作负反馈计算。例4:系统结构图如图所示:R(s)C(s) + -写出闭环传递函数。 num1=10;den1=1 1 0;num2=0.2 1;den2=0.01 1;num,den=feedback(num1,den1,num2,den2,-1); printsys(num,den)显示:num/den = 0.1 s + 10-0.01 s3 + 1.01 s2 + 3 s + 10串联连接用函数series,格式:num,den=series(num1,den1,num2,den2)并联连接用函数parallel,格式:num,den=parallel(num1,den1,num2,den2)例:略二、控制系统时间响应分析1、阶跃响应阶跃响应函数格式1:step(num,den)或step(a,b,c,d) ,给定num,den求系统的阶跃响应并作响应曲线图,时间t的范围自动设定。 格式2: step(num,den,t)或step(a,b,c,d,t)时间t的范围人工给定,等间隔(如,t=0:0.1:10)。 格式3:y,x=step(num,den)或y,x=step(a,b,c,d)返回变量输出y、状态x,不作图。 格式4:y,x,t=step(num,den)或y,x=step(num,den,t) 包括或不包括时间t。例5:系统传递函数为,求阶跃响应,并作性能分析。num=4;den=1 1 4;step(num,den)响应曲线如图:计算峰值时间:y,x,t=step(num,den);ymax=max(y);%求y的最大值。tp=spline(y,t,ymax)%用插值算法计算峰值时间。tp= 1.60622、脉冲响应脉冲响应函数格式1:impulse(num,den)或impulse(a,b,c,d) ,给定num,den求系统的脉冲响应并作响应曲线图,时间t的范围自动设定。 格式2:impulse(num,den,t)或impulse(a,b,c,d,t),时间t的范围人工给定,等间隔(如,t=0:0.1:10)。 格式3:y,x=impulse(num,den)或y,x=impulse(a,b,c,d)返回变量输出y、状态x,不作图。 格式4:y,x,t=impulse(num,den)或y,x=impulse(num,den,t) 包括或不包括时间t,不作图。3、系统特征参数wn,z=damp(den) 计算系统的无阻尼自然振荡频率wn和阻尼比z。den为特征多项式系数向量(因为MATLAB语言中只用英文字母,而不用希腊字母,故用wn及z分别代替和)。例7:den=1 3 3; wn,z=damp(den)wn = 1.7321 1.7321z = 0.8660 0.8660damp(den) 立即显示格式,列表显示特征根、阻尼比和自然频率。例8:den=1 2 10;damp(den) Eigenvalue(特征根) Damping(阻尼比) Freq. (rad/s) (自然频率) -1.00e+000 + 3.00e+000i 3.16e-001 3.16e+000 -1.00e+000 - 3.00e+000i 3.16e-001 3 .16e+000 三、控制系统频率响应分析1、对数频率特性作图,即波德图。格式1:bode(num,den)或bode(a,b,c,d,iu) 给定开环系统的数学模型作波德图,频率向量w自动给出。当开环模型以状态空间模型给出时,需指定第几个输入iu,SISO时iu省略。格式2:bode(num,den,w)或bode(a,b,c,d,iu,w) 给定开环系统的数学模型作波德图,频率向量w人工给出。w的单位为rad/s,可以由命令logspace得到对数等分的w值。格式3:m,p,w=bode(num,den)或m,p,w=bode(a,b,c,d,iu) 返回变量格式,不作图。其中m为频率特性G(jw)的幅值向量,m=G(jw);p为频率特性G(jw)的幅角向量,p=argG(jw),单位为度(o);w 为频率向量,单位为rad/s。例9:控制系统的开环传递函数为,作波德图峰值大小Mr与该点的频率wr。num=10;den=1 2 10;bode(num,den);grid onm,p,w=bode(num,den);mr=max(m)mr = 1.6667wr=spline(m,w,mr)wr =2.82842、用semilogx绘制系统对数频率特性:例10:不使用bode命令,作出的对数频率特性。w=logspace(-1,1);%从10-1到101之间作对数等分分度,默认产生50个元素的对数等间隔向量;若写为w=logspace(-1,1,1000)则表示产生1000个元素的对数等间隔向量。这里我们采用默认格式,即50个元素。m=20*log10(10./abs(i*w).2+2*i*w+10);semilogx(w,m)3、计算系统的稳定裕量,包括相位裕量Gm和幅值裕量Pm。格式1:margin(num,den)或margin(a,b,c,d) 给定开环系统的数学模型,作波德图,并在图上标注幅值裕量Gm和对应的频率wg,相位裕量Pm和对应的频率wp。格式2:Gm,Pm,wg,wp=margin(num,den)或Gm,Pm,wg,wp=margin(a,b,c,d) 返回变量,不作图。返回幅值裕量Gm和对应的频率wg,相位裕量Pm和对应的频率wp。格式3:Gm,Pm,wg,wp=margin(m,p,w) 给定频率特性的参数向量、幅值m、相位p和频率w,由插值算法计算幅值裕度Gm和对应的频率wg,相位裕量Pm和对应的频率wp。例10:控制系统结构如图所示,求系统稳定裕度,并分别采用格式2和3比较计算误差。 + -n=2;d=1 3 2 0; margin(n,d); gm1,pm1,wg1,wp1=margin(n,d);注意:这里返回的gm1是实际幅值裕度,并非对数值,所以显示的gm1=3.0000,而上图中的Gm=9.5424是对数幅值裕度。即Gm=20lg(gm1) 。ans = 3.0000 32.6133 1.4142 0.7494m,p,w=bode(n
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年地热发电行业研究报告及未来行业发展趋势预测
- 中国邮政2025大连市秋招网点柜员岗位高频笔试题库含答案
- 2025年VOCs催化剂行业研究报告及未来行业发展趋势预测
- 中国邮政集团2025宝鸡市秋招笔试题库含答案
- 招聘流程简化及候选人评估模板
- 2025年电力数据集成系统行业研究报告及未来行业发展趋势预测
- 2025年柴油发电机行业研究报告及未来行业发展趋势预测
- 铜川王益区中烟工业2025秋招安全工程师岗位面试模拟题及答案
- 中国邮政集团2025银川市秋招面试典型题目及参考答案
- 中国邮政2025白城市秋招风险控制岗位面试模拟题及答案
- 农贸市场装修施工方案
- 2022年广东双百社工笔试真题及答案
- EPLAN电气设计 课件全套 陈乾 任务1-15 初识Eplan、Eplan的安装-图纸设计与电气元件选型练习
- 【拆书阅读笔记】-《网飞文化手册》
- 四川公路工程竣工文件资料编制实施细则
- 提升家庭教育指导能力
- 设备借用协议范本
- 交安工程施工合同
- 高中生物选择性必修一知识点总结
- 肠造口并发症讲稿课件
- GB/T 6403.5-2008砂轮越程槽
评论
0/150
提交评论